Question
what are the input and output values for determining the sine of 60°?
o input: 60°; output: $\frac{sqrt{3}}{2}$
o input: $\frac{sqrt{3}}{2}$; output: 60°
o input: 60°; output: $\frac{2}{sqrt{3}}$
o input: $\frac{2}{sqrt{3}}$; output: 60°
Step1: Recall sine - function definition
The sine of an angle in a right - triangle is defined as $\sin\theta=\frac{\text{opposite}}{\text{hypotenuse}}$.
Step2: Identify sides for 60° angle
In right - triangle $ABC$, for the $60^{\circ}$ angle at $B$, the opposite side to the $60^{\circ}$ angle is $AC = 8\sqrt{3}$ and the hypotenuse is $AB = 16$.
Step3: Calculate $\sin60^{\circ}$
$\sin60^{\circ}=\frac{8\sqrt{3}}{16}=\frac{\sqrt{3}}{2}$. The input is the angle $60^{\circ}$ and the output is the ratio $\frac{\sqrt{3}}{2}$.
